Overview
Job holders within this Group Profile will report to the Deputy
Governor and be responsible for managing a function within an
establishment which has been defined as standard complexity,
including management of all staff within the function.
The job holder will need to ensure that they implement robust
systems to manage the function, as they will often be distanced
from front-line duties and will need to delegate appropriately.
They will be required to robustly apply national policies in their
area and draft local policies accordingly
These are operational prisoner facing roles.
Characteristics
Typical tasks associated with this Group Profile include:
• Act as the Governor's representative by chairing adjudications
and taking charge of day-to-day establishment operations as
Duty Governor
• Promote Prison Service policy in all activities and behaviours
e.g. promote diversity, decency, safety and reducing re-
offending agendas
• Review open Assessment Care in Custody teamwork (ACCT)
as and when required in line with audit baselines
• Provide leadership and management of the Function. Will
have the skills to apply all Human Resources (HR) related
policies and practices and be able to carry out all aspects of
people management such as Attendance Management,
Disciplinary Investigations, Performance Management and
Staff Appraisals
• Manage Prisoners Complaints Process within the Function
• Responsible for ensuring all litigation claims relevant to the
area have been dealt with in accordance with policy
• Oversee the compilation and regular progress reporting of
performance improvement programmes
• Manage the appropriate authorisation of Financial Compliance
Statements
HMPPS OR T 6 GP : Head of Function Standard Operational v11.0
• Manage devolved budgets in accordance with the financial
procedures outlined in the budget delegation
• Ensure that the Function produces and analyses audit and
establishment performance management information
identifying variances and areas requiring improvements
• Contribute to the establishment’s overall achievement of
(SDIs) and standards and be accountable for the performance
and delivery of targets relating to the budget; People Plan for
the Function.
• Accountable for all local and national policies relating to the
Function, and ensure procedures implemented are compliant,
including the development of new policies
• Contribute to the development and delivery of the medium-to-
long term strategic and business plan for the establishment,
with overall responsibility for implementation within their
Function
• Attend relevant boards/meetings and actively contribute either
as chair or team member
• Responsible for ensuring the defined work areas and
associated activities comply with Health and Safety legislation.
Ensure all risk assessments are undertaken and staff are
made aware of their personal responsibility towards Health and
Safety compliance
• Contribute to the preparation of the establishment contingency
and emergency plans and ensure implementation when
required.
• Ensure the effective use of staff resources and the provision of
training and annual leave opportunities
• Produce relevant reports as required and ensure that the
response to all correspondence are within agreed timescales
• Carry out investigations and administration in relation to
incidents of potential discrimination and report on findings
• Accountable for ensuring actions arising from Standard Audit,
His Majesty Inspectorate of Prisons (HMIP) Action Plans and
Managing Quality of Prison Life (MQPL) surveys, including
local self audit action plans and Resettlement strategies, are
delivered
• Deliver and implement projects as directed by the Governor
• Actively encourage staff engagement within the Function to
ensure objectives are met

Hours of Work
37 hour week
and Allowances
Required Hours Allowance - TBC by Recruiting Manager
This role requires working regular unsocial hours and a payment
at the current approved organisation rate will be made in addition
to your basic pay to recognise this.
Unsocial hours are those hours outside 0700 - 1900hrs Monday
to Friday and include working evenings, nights, weekends and
Bank/Public Holidays.
